Network Structures
The arrangement and interconnection of elements in a system, often referring to how people or positions are interconnected within organizations.
Core Organization
The fundamental, central part of an organization that is essential for its operation and defines its main purpose.
Matrix Structure
An organizational framework that combines two or more types of organizational structures, typically functional and product-based divisions, to leverage the benefits of both.
Conflict
A situation where two or more parties disagree due to opposing needs, desires, beliefs, or values, which can occur between individuals, groups, or organizations.
